It additionally delves into methods for enhancing group effectiveness and attaining higher experiences or goals. In studies of group therapy, universality has been consistently identified by members as some of the efficient parts of the treatment (Yalom & Leszcz, 2020). In analysis, most members report that the group experience led to higher universality and belonging, and when it did, this predicts higher symptom improvement. Universality and the sense of belonging that groups result in are a major pressure in therapeutic, and outcomes in their own right. There is actual strength to be found in true reference to others, being part of a bigger neighborhood, and learning that non-public struggles don't have to be hidden. Although Yalom and [=%3Ca%20href=https://Flipz.top/5deu4y%3EConhe%C3%A7A%20Mais%3C/a%3E ConheçA Mais] Leszcz (2020) have been writing about universality for many years, it is not often included as a bunch end result measure.

Other contingencies could also be that the suggestions giver receives verbal or nonverbal suggestions from her friends or supervisor punishing the way by which she gave the suggestions. The group supervision experience permits individuals to be in a scenario to interact in various skilled behaviors and experience contingencies offered from multiple listeners for their conduct. There are many potential training and mentoring benefits of the group supervision format if the expertise is well-designed. In fact, some authors counsel that group supervision may be one of many solely forums to cultivate professional repertoires wanted to obtain success with certain clinical populations, corresponding to people with autism (Bernstein & Dotson, 2010). The efficient professional requires a excessive degree of intellectual and interpersonal abilities, and accordingly, these authors encourage frequent peer and supervisor feedback. Hybrid periods, the place some members attend in particular person while others be a part of remotely, current distinctive challenges. Success requires thoughtful room setup that allows digital members to see and hear everybody, expertise checks earlier than beginning, and generally a co-facilitator dedicated to monitoring the net experience. When accomplished well, hybrid codecs can supply the most effective of both worlds—the power of in-person interaction and the accessibility of digital participation. Clear camera etiquette helps create a virtual surroundings that feels protected and skilled. We ask members to keep cameras on during sessions (with reasonable exceptions for temporary necessities), find private places free from interruptions, and mute when not speaking to reduce background noise.

RF permits us to intuit others’ motivations and shield ourselves from threats, working in conjunction with empathy to understand and relate throughout totally different views. Safe attachments, the place caregivers are thinking about and purpose to understand the infant’s separate thoughts, create a secure sufficient environment in which the toddler can begin exploring different people’s minds (Fonagy et al., 2017). Epistemic belief opens us up to absorb information from a safe base relationship. Quite than relying solely on private studying, ET allows us to simply accept information passed onto us from people experienced as benevolent and trustworthy. Although there have been many studies linking ET and RF to psychopathology and individual remedy (Fonagy et al., 2002), much less attention has been given to making use of these constructs in teams. As an exception, Fonagy et al. (2017) elucidated how remedy groups can foster RF by encouraging members to share totally different perspectives and addressing when assumptions are made about what another is thinking or feeling. When the group is functioning as a safe base, it facilitates members’ ability to tolerate painful feelings and discover others’ minds.
